
The event was attended by leaders of units under the Ministry, representatives of the Hanoi and Ho Chi Minh City Departments of Culture and Sports , along with more than 40 KOL management companies (MCNs) and major online content platforms and channels such as TikTok, Zalo, Tuyen Van Hoa, The Anh 28, Schannel, BeatVN, DatVietVAC, VCCorp...
This is the first time the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ism has organized a large-scale conference to directly connect with multi-channel network management companies and content creators, a force playing an increasingly important role in the national information ecosystem.
Speaking at the conference, Permanent Deputy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ism Le Hai Binh emphasized that defining social media in political , economic, and social life is necessary, reflecting the spirit of partnership between the State and the creative community, jointly building a healthy and humane information environment.
According to Deputy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ism Le Hai Binh, social media has become a new pillar in the national cultural and information ecosystem, contributing to the dissemination of Vietnamese cultural values and people.
This event marks a significant turning point in This shifts the mindset of media management from a management model to one of partnership and guidance, from supervision to collaboration with social media forces, aiming to professionalize content creation and disseminate Vietnamese cultural and human values in the new era.
Many delegates attending the conference agreed that social media is not just a communication tool, but also an open cultural space where national identity, lifestyle, and emotions are recreated daily. When content creators focus on humanistic values, and when "influencers" become "spreaders of Vietnamese values," social media will become a strategic soft power for the nation.
According to Mr. Le Quang Tu Do, Director of the Department of Radio, Television and Electronic Information, the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ism will maintain monthly information sessions, aiming to build a network of cooperation between management agencies, MCNs, and content creators, helping social media keep pace with mainstream journalism, while spreading positive values and a good image of the country.
This event also reflects efforts to establish a new connection mechanism between the State and social creative forces – a suitable direction in an era where a nation's "soft power" lies not only in policy, but also in its ability to spread Vietnamese emotions, images, and cultural values in the digital space, where national identity, lifestyle, language, and emotions are recreated and disseminated every day.
